I need some clarification on how much EO to use in my 4lb (64oz) batch of soap. I am making a soap with lavender, peppermint, tea tree, rosemary, and eucalyptus. I used the B.berry calculator and found the recommended amounts for each (medium strength) and then divided by 5 because that is the number of different oils I am using. However, I only come up with 1.5oz of EO for the entire batch. That seems really low. I would think I would need about 4oz of EO for a 64oz batch. Is there something I am missing?

Lavender-3oz/5 = .6
Peppermint-1oz/5 = .2
Tea Tree-2oz/5 = .4
Rosemary-1oz/5 = .2
Eucalyptus-.5oz/5 = .1

I use the general rule of thumb of no more that 3% EO total weight. Then, I fiddle around with the percentage of each of the oils in the blend until I get a combo that I like.

There are a few EO that need to be used at a smaller concentration - cinnamon is the main one that I use. I use it at .5-1% because it can be an irritant, and there are no issues with the scent sticking.
 
That seems about right to me maybe just a little low. You could go just a touch higher with oils that don't irritate skin. I use around 5% EO of my total OIL weight. Yesterday I made an orange spice batch with only EO's
For a 70oz batch:
1.5 orange
.5 clove
.5 cinnamon

I un-molded this morning and the scent strength seems just right. Not light, not so overpowering that I could smell it thought my house.

I would use .8 oz each of lavender & tea tree. (6% x 64oz / 5) and .4 each of peppermint, rosemary & eucalyptus (3% x 64 / 5) for the total of 2.8 oz. I do a similiar mix and have never had a problem with complaints. I agree with the not over 1% for irritant eo's. Normally I use 6% and tweak from there for the lower useage oils. Peppermint I never use over 3% as it is can burn and I warn customers of the use of peppermint soap in sensitive areas.
